Allen-Bradley 5069-IB8S: Sourcing Strategy & Asset Return Value in a Constrained Supply Chain

The Allen-Bradley 5069-IB8S is an 8-point, 24V DC sourcing digital input module designed for the Compact 5000 I/O platform — the backbone of Rockwell Automation's CompactLogix and Compact GuardLogix safety controller ecosystems. Procurement Specifications

Part Number 5069-IB8S
Brand Allen-Bradley (Rockwell Automation)
Series Compact 5000 I/O
Module Type Digital Input, Safety-Rated
Number of Inputs 8 Points
Input Voltage 24V DC Sourcing
Safety Rating SIL 2 / PLd (IEC 62061 / ISO 13849)
Compatible Controllers CompactLogix 5380, Compact GuardLogix 5380
